Abstract

The present invention provides a magnetic tape drive mounting detection apparatus in a composite type magnetic tape apparatus, which detection can surely detecting that a magnetic tape drive is mounted at a predetermined position, while absorbing irregularities between parts. The detection apparatus detects that a magnetic tape drive fixed onto a deck tray sliding in a frame is mounted on a predetermined position of a magnetic tape apparatus. The detection apparatus includes: a fixed plate spring attached to the deck tray for fixing the magnetic tape drive at a predetermined position; and a micro switch attached unitarily with the fixed plate spring . The micro switch performs detection operation at a position where the fixed plate spring is firmly fixed to the frame
